Quality Control Interview Questions
"The requirements and employee expectations for quality control jobs vary widely by position, company, and product lifecycle stage you will be working on. Since most quality control jobs will revolve around testing products and responding to consumer feedback, employers will expect you to have excellent customer service skills and pay close attention to detail. To stand out above the other candidates, be sure to do extensive research on the products you will be working on and tools and instruments you will be expected to use."
